CCBC Essex Men's Soccer Ties Mercer County CC

Several college teams will see action this weekend.

By Robert J. Aupperley, CCBC Essex Interim Athletic Administrator

CCBC Essex men's soccer fought to a 1-1 tie in double overtime Thursday at Mercer County Community College. The Knights are now 8-4-3 and will travel to Chesapeake on Monday for the season finale. They will participate in the NJCAA Region XX Tournament on Oct. 23 at Harford Community College. 

The women’s soccer team travels to Mercer County on Saturday and to The Community College of Rhode Island on Sunday to complete its regular season.

The Lady Knights will participate in the NJCAA Region XX Tournament at Harford on Thursday, Oct. 24. 

The Women’s volleyball team hosts CCBC Catonsville tonight for a 7 p.m. showdown in the Wellness Center. 

The men’s lacrosse team will host the alumni tonight as part of a doubleheader with Eastern Tech and their alumni. Game time for the CCBC Essex alumni game is 8 p.m. 

The women’s cross country team travels to Hood College on Saturday.
